首页 > 数据库技术 > 详细

MyBatis+Oracle

时间:2020-01-11 21:32:34      阅读:81      评论:0      收藏:0      [点我收藏+]

一、聚合函数查询

1.配置实体类

package com.demo;

public class demo {
  //接收集合函数
  private String count;
  private String sum;

}

2.配置MyBatis映射

.xml

<?xml version="1.0" encoding="UTF-8" ?>  
<!DOCTYPE mapper PUBLIC "-//ibatis.apache.org//DTD Mapper 3.0//EN"      
	"http://ibatis.apache.org/dtd/ibatis-3-mapper.dtd">

<mapper namespace="com.demo.demoDao">
	
	<resultMap id="demo" type="com.demo.demo">
		<result column="count" property="count"/>
		<result column="sum" property="sum"/>
	</resultMap>

	<select id="getSum" resultMap="demo">
		SELECT
		    count(*) as count,
		    sum(*) as sum
		FROM
			table_name
	</select>
</mapper>

.java

package com.demo;

public interface demoDao{

    public demo getSum(demo demo);

}

  

3.业务层

package com.demo;

@Service
public class demoService{

	@Autowired
	private demoDao demoDao;
        
        public void getSum(Demo demo){
        Demo result = demoDao.getsum(demo);
        String sum = result.getsum;
        String count = result.getCount();
      }


}    

  

MyBatis+Oracle

原文:https://www.cnblogs.com/zhang20190701/p/12181101.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!